Fact Friday: Truck /private vehicle accidents


 File:AmericanTruckingAssociations logo.jpg


In a recent study by the American Trucking Association, they found that smaller vehicles are responsible for most car/truck accidents in the country.  In fact,  the survey revealed that 81% of accidents were the fault of smaller vehicles, and truck drivers were at fault only 27% of the time.

Fact Friday: The Port of Houston


 

Fact Friday:

The Port of Houston Authority
The Port of Houston is a 25-mile-long complex of diversified public and private facilities located just a few hours' sailing time from the Gulf of Mexico. The port is ranked first in the United States in foreign waterborne tonnage (14 consecutive years); first in U.S. imports (20 consecutive years); second in U.S. export tonnage and second in the U.S. in total tonnage (20 consecutive years)

UPDATES: Chassis Rentals

American Presidents Lines (APL) has joined the ever growing list of Lines that are no longer providing chassis in Houston, as of April 15th  2013 and OOCL will no longer provide chassis in Houston, as of July 1, 2013.

In addition several of our carriers have announced an increase in Daily Chassis Rental Rates to $25.00 per day.
